Urban Energy Corporation (hereinafter "Urban Energy"), a power company wholly owned by JFE Engineering Corporation, began providing a circular renewable energy system centered on food recycling using the "Electricity Creation Returning®" power plan*1 to The Monogatari Corporation (hereinafter "Monogatari Corporation")'s factory from April 1, 2025.
The service proposed by Urban Energy involves recycling food waste generated during food processing at Monogatari Food Factory and Monogatari Food Lab, operated by Monogatari Corporation in Komaki City. The waste is processed through methane fermentation and recycling power generation at Bios Komaki Co., Ltd. (hereinafter "Bios Komaki"), a subsidiary of J&T Recycling Corporation (hereinafter "J&T Recycling") located in the same city. Urban Energy purchases the generated electricity and supplies it to Monogatari Corporation's factory.
Furthermore, by using non-fossil certificates, a "circular renewable energy system" is realized where part of the electricity used is effectively sourced from the company's own renewable energy, expecting to reduce CO2 emissions by approximately 333 tons annually.
This initiative was realized through collaboration between Monogatari Corporation and the JFE Group, based on the "Partnership Agreement for Promoting Decarbonization and Resource Circulation Centered on Food Recycling in Komaki City" signed in January 2025 between Komaki City and three JFE Group companies, as part of Monogatari Corporation's proactive sustainability activities.
Monogatari Corporation aims to contribute to solving social issues, including climate change response and sustainable development, while pursuing the dual goals of creating a "prosperous society" and becoming a "brand and company essential to customers."
*1 "Electricity Creation Returning®": A service where Urban Energy purchases electricity generated from waste and supplies it to waste-generating facilities, offering electricity rate discounts based on waste volume. This unique service has been provided by the power retailer since 2017.
